#ba91e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ba91e6 is composed of 72.9% red, 56.9%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.1% cyan, 37%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 268.9 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 73.5%. #ba91e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7523cd.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#ba91e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f6f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ba91e6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bbbbc is the less saturated color, while #b97cfb is the most saturated one.
